在对话框中引入一个CView指针,指向主窗口,在创建对话框时(构造函数中)将主窗口的指针传给他就行。如果重载OnOK函数的话,也可以将对话框设置成无模式对话框。

解决方案 »

  1.   

    这样的话,当您的窗口被别人遮住而再打开或者别的情况,您的对话框画的东东都不见了.....
    所以最好还是在 View 的 OnDraw 根据 Doc 的数据成员画。
    而对话框的 OnOK() , 把您要作的改变放到 Doc 的数据成员中,然后 InvilidateRect....
      

  2.   

    我的目的就是在关闭对话框的同时,将输入的数据用于在主窗口内绘图,因为不能直接在XXX::ondraw()内写代码,所以不知道从何下手。
    入门真是辛苦,望各位前辈多帮忙,谢了